No one gets to choose to attend any of the academy’s. You must be appointed.

You need a nomination first in order to be eligible to receive an appointment. You are required to receive a nomination from a nominating authority in order to attend the Naval Academy.

That would be the two senators and the four representatives from Iowa (must be from where the candidate resides) or the sitting vice president.

If Kolat wants him, I’m sure they could get it done but if he wants to be an officer and create, it is more likely that he go to any university that has an ROTC program and wrestling.

it would be very rare.
